Ejemplo n.º 1
0
        private void DeleteDzienTyg_Click_ItemClick(object sender, DevExpress.Xpf.Bars.ItemClickEventArgs e)
        {
            ArItHarmonogramNaglDniWolne ith = new ArItHarmonogramNaglDniWolne();

            if (row == null)
            {
                MessageBox.Show("Wybierz Rok z Listy");
                return;
            }


            if (ComboBoxDzienTyg.Text == String.Empty)
            {
                MessageBox.Show("Wybierz Dzień Tygodnia");
                return;
            }


            int numerDnia = (int)ComboBoxDzienTyg.EditValue;

            if (row != null)
            {
                HarmonogramDataAdapter hDa = new HarmonogramDataAdapter();
                int IdArItHarmonogramNagl  = row.IdArItHarmonogramNagl;
                hDa.DelDniWolneDlaDnia(IdArItHarmonogramNagl, numerDnia, mUwagi.Text);
                PokazHarmonogram(row.Rok);
                PokazDniWolne(row.IdArItHarmonogramNagl);
                Messenger.Default.Send <int>(1);
            }
        }
Ejemplo n.º 2
0
        private void Item_PropertyChanged(object sender, System.ComponentModel.PropertyChangedEventArgs e)
        {
            HarmonogramDataAdapter hda = new HarmonogramDataAdapter();
            ArItHarmonogram        row = (ArItHarmonogram)sender;

            hda.PrzepiszDane(row);
        }
Ejemplo n.º 3
0
        private void DelDzien_ItemClick(object sender, DevExpress.Xpf.Bars.ItemClickEventArgs e)
        {
            ArItHarmonogramNaglDniWolne ith = new ArItHarmonogramNaglDniWolne();

            if (row == null)
            {
                MessageBox.Show("Wybierz Rok z Listy");
                return;
            }
            DateTime data = dtData.DateTime;


            if (row != null)
            {
                if (row.Rok != data.Year)
                {
                    MessageBox.Show("Wybierz właściwy okres (Rok)");
                    return;
                }
                HarmonogramDataAdapter hDa = new HarmonogramDataAdapter();
                ith.IdArItHarmonogramNagl = row.IdArItHarmonogramNagl;
                hDa.DelDzienWolny(ith, data, mUwagi.Text);
                PokazHarmonogram(row.Rok);
                PokazDniWolne(row.IdArItHarmonogramNagl);
                Messenger.Default.Send <int>(1);
            }
        }
Ejemplo n.º 4
0
 private void deleteRowItem_ItemClick(object sender, DevExpress.Xpf.Bars.ItemClickEventArgs e)
 {
     if (row != null)
     {
         HarmonogramDataAdapter.DelHarmonogram(row.IdArItHarmonogramNagl);
         PokazHarmonogramNagl();
     }
 }
Ejemplo n.º 5
0
 private void btnDodajRok_Click(object sender, RoutedEventArgs e)
 {
     try
     {
         row = (ArItHarmonogramNagl)gridControl.SelectedItem;
         if (row != null)
         {
             HarmonogramDataAdapter hda = new HarmonogramDataAdapter();
             hda.GenHarmonogram();
             PokazHarmonogramNagl();
             MessageBox.Show("Wygenerowane");
         }
         else
         {
             MessageBox.Show("Wybierz Rok");
         }
     }
     catch (Exception ex)
     {
         MessageBox.Show("Wystąpiły błedy przy pobieraniu listy harmonogramu -sprawdz logi błedu:" + ex.Message);
         throw ex;
     }
 }
Ejemplo n.º 6
0
 private void btnDniWolne_Click(object sender, RoutedEventArgs e)
 {
     try
     {
         row = (ArItHarmonogramNagl)gridControl.SelectedItem;
         if (row != null)
         {
             HarmonogramDataAdapter hda = new HarmonogramDataAdapter();
             hda.GenDniWolne(row.IdArItHarmonogramNagl);
             PokazDniWolne(row.IdArItHarmonogramNagl);
             Messenger.Default.Send <int>(1);
         }
         else
         {
             MessageBox.Show("Wybierz Rok");
         }
     }
     catch (Exception ex)
     {
         MessageBox.Show("Wystąpiły błedy przy pobieraniu listy harmonogramu -sprawdz logi błedu:" + ex.Message);
         throw ex;
     }
 }
Ejemplo n.º 7
0
        private void PokazDniWolne(int IdNagl)
        {
            List <ArItHarmonogramNaglDniWolne> lstHarNagl = HarmonogramDataAdapter.GetHarmonogramDniWolne(IdNagl);

            gridDniWolne.ItemsSource = lstHarNagl;
        }
Ejemplo n.º 8
0
        private void PokazHarmonogram(int rok)
        {
            List <ArItHarmonogram> lstHarNagl = HarmonogramDataAdapter.GetHarmonogramRok(rok);

            gridHarmonogram.ItemsSource = lstHarNagl;
        }
Ejemplo n.º 9
0
        private void PokazHarmonogramNagl()
        {
            List <ArItHarmonogramNagl> lstHarNagl = HarmonogramDataAdapter.GetHarmonogramNagl();

            gridControl.ItemsSource = lstHarNagl;
        }